I had just prepared two keyboards for the dish washer, keycaps in the cutlery basket and all when I realized there were no more dishwasher tabs. And shops were closed.

Well, a quick search on Google showed that it seems to be common knowledge, but I did not know that you must not use dishwashing liquid instead.

After a while the dishwasher didn't make its usual washing noise. I opened the door and found tons of foam :eek:. I had to take it out all by hand. Several times.

Now it seems to do its job again. I hope. I should just check it once more.

I didn't want to learn that, even if you have no plans of engaging the clutch, selecting 1st gear at 40 MPH makes the clutch spin much, much faster than it's designed to spin. 8000 RPM makes a VW diesel clutch go *boom*.
